Who we are

World Class chamber, jazz, and world music is what defines the Civic Music Association of Des Moines. CMA was established in 1925 by three visionary women who believed that Des Moines should be a place where the world’s greatest musicians should come to perform. The mission of CMA is to engage, enrich, and educate the central Iowa community through provocative, world-class musical performances by legends and rising stars.
